LARRY CARLSON April 22, 1949 - February 28, 2014 Peacefully on Friday February 28, 2014 Larry passed away at the St. Boniface Hospital after a lengthy illness. Left to cherish his memory is his wife and best friend of 41 years Rita, sons, Chad, Luc, and Cody daughter Alexis, his little girl and Brindel his fur buddy. Larry loved his family and was proud of his children. Dad was predeceased by his parents Alfred, and Alma Carlson, brothers Edward, Allen and Sheldon, nephew Kelsey, father-in law Luc Lambert, brother-in-law Aime Lambert, and nephew Daniel Lambert and his budda, his fur buddy Tanger. Dad also leaves behind his remaining siblings and large extended family and friends. Thank you to the St. Boniface Hospital and health care aides for the excellent care given to our Dad. Sleep peacefully Dad, we will always love and remember you. Until we meet again. Love your family. As per Larry's request there will be no formal service.
